BiH Minister of Foreign Affairs Elmedin Konakovic on an Official Visit to Washington

The Minister of Foreign Affairs of Bosnia and Herzegovina, Elmedin Konaković, will be in the United States from March 23 to 26, 2026, where he will participate in a series of meetings with senior administration officials and members of Congress and the Senate.

As part of the visit, Minister Konaković will be one of the guests at an event dedicated to the promotion of the Sarajevo Haggadah, which will be held on March 24, 2026, on Capitol Hill in Washington. The event will bring together representatives of the US administration, Congress and Senate, as well as representatives of religious communities from Bosnia and Herzegovina and the United States.

The program will emphasize the universal values ​​of interreligious solidarity, courage and cooperation between communities, the protection of cultural heritage in times of conflict, and shared responsibility in opposing all forms of persecution and discrimination.

The Sarajevo Haggadah, as one of the most important symbols of the cultural heritage of Bosnia and Herzegovina, carries a strong message of solidarity and humanity. Its history is a testament to how, in the most difficult times, individuals and communities have protected values ​​that transcend religious and national divisions, demonstrating that the preservation of cultural heritage and the protection of human dignity are inextricably linked.

In the context of contemporary global challenges, including the rise of religious intolerance, Islamophobia, anti-Semitism and other forms of discrimination, this event sends a clear message about the importance of joint action to protect fundamental human values.
